Pros

Company very supportive of its employees, with respectable core values. Good products and people, good working environment. Reasonable salary packages.

Cons

Increased competition from the chinese telecommunications vendors is putting pressure on Ericsson's business, impacting local working conditions (flexibility required involving travelling, trend of outsourcing to low-cost countries).

Pros

- Ericsson have great people on the ground within the organisation that really support you when needed - Global organisation so good opportunities are there if you can travel - Good experience for career and CV/resume, you can develop really good skills in Ericsson, but you have to actively pursure these opportunities yourself. - I have laughed more in this organisation, overall a great bunch of people who are a pleasure to work with!

Cons

I have worked globally, this review is based on organisation in Ireland only. - The business has changed and managers are very slow to change their thinking, an old boys club who are supported by a very poor HR. - Lots of travel and high pressure for utilisation for 'working staff', no down time - lip service paid to it only, lots of people close to burnout - in contrast those well connected get soft assignments so its not equal pain in E///. - Blame culture is rampant in local Dublin office, can be a horrible place to work - No real recognition (or understanding by management) of a job well done only pressure for the next assignment. - middle management are weak, they may have been good technically at one time or else were 'well connected' but morph into administrators who have no customer facing work. No credability as managers. - senior management are self serving - more loyal to their career than the organisation they are assigned, - no trust left, nobody believes what management say anymore, been caught out with lies too many times - jobs for the boys and the in cliche is rife, bullying behaviours are common and seen as the ability to be tough, HR supports this - ask anyone with a morsel of integrity who has reported such behaviour to HR and see where they are now. - No understanding of leadership, its sad as they believe they are leaders but no one is following. - Fundamental problem is that the Core Values of respect professionalism and perseverance are paid lip service and largely ignored. Assumptions of 'how we do things' that conflict with core values are the directors of behaviour and thinking. Unless this changes, nothing else will.
